Maranatha Baptist University Acceptance rate and admissions statistics

Maranatha Baptist University has an acceptance rate of 72% and is among the top 35% of the most difficult universities to gain admission to in the United States. The university reports the admission statistics without distinguishing between local and international students.

The average net cost to attend Maranatha Baptist University is $28,415 per year, calculated as the sum of the average cost of tuition, room and board, books, and supplies, reduced by the amount of average financial aid received.

The final cost of attendance varies for each student based on household income, residency, program, and other factors.

  4. Ben Peterson

    Ben Peterson
    Born in
    United States Flag United States
    Years
    1950-.. (age 76)
    Occupations
    amateur wrestler
    Biography

    Benjamin Lee Peterson is a retired American freestyle wrestler. He competed at the 1972 and 1976 Olympics and won a gold and a silver medal, respectively. As a college wrestler, Peterson was a two-time NCAA champion at Iowa State. He founded the "Camp of Champs," which brought in Olympic wrestlers to train with high schoolers. Peterson also coached wrestling at Maranatha Baptist University for 28 years.
